Aptos оптимистичное параллельное выполнение: высокопроизводительное безопасное решение RWA и PayFi

Глубокое понимание жизненного цикла транзакций в Блокчейн: Сравнение технологий Эфир, Solana и Aptos

При сравнении технических характеристик различных публичных блокчейнов крайне важно выбрать подходящую точку входа. Жизненный цикл транзакции является идеальной аналитической перспективой, которая охватывает весь процесс транзакции от создания до окончательного обновления состояния, включая ключевые этапы, такие как создание и инициирование, трансляция, сортировка, выполнение и обновление состояния. С помощью этой перспективы мы можем четко понять проектные идеи и технические компромиссы каждого публичного блокчейна.

В данной статье будет рассмотрен Aptos, его уникальный дизайн, а также проведено сравнение с Ethereum и Solana, в котором будут обсуждены ключевые различия в обработке транзакций.

Глубокое и простое понимание основных различий между Ethereum, Solana и Aptos на протяжении жизненного цикла одной транзакции

Aptos: Оптимистичное параллельное выполнение и высокопроизводительный дизайн

Aptos, как высокопроизводительный публичный блокчейн, имеет жизненный цикл транзакций, похожий на Эфир, но достигает значительного повышения производительности благодаря уникальному оптимистичному параллельному выполнению и оптимизации пула памяти.

Создание и инициирование

Сеть Aptos состоит из легких узлов, полных узлов и валидаторов. Пользователи инициируют транзакции через легкие узлы (например, кошельки или приложения), легкие узлы передают транзакции ближайшим полным узлам, полные узлы затем синхронизируются с валидаторами.

трансляция

Aptos сохранил пул памяти, но после QuorumStore пулы памяти больше не разделяются. В отличие от Ethereum, пул памяти Aptos не только является буфером для транзакций, но и предварительно сортирует транзакции по правилам (таким как FIFO или стоимость газа), чтобы гарантировать отсутствие конфликтов при последующем параллельном выполнении. Эта конструкция избегает высоких аппаратных требований, аналогичных Solana, которые требуют предварительного объявления наборов на чтение и запись.

сортировка

Aptos использует механизм консенсуса AptosBFT. Предлагающий, в принципе, не может свободно упорядочить транзакции, но aip-68 дает предлагающему дополнительные права на заполнение задержанных транзакций. Поскольку предварительная сортировка в памяти была завершена для избежания конфликтов, генерация блоков больше зависит от сотрудничества между валидаторами, а не от ведущего предлагающего.

Выполнение

Aptos использует технологию Block-STM для реализации оптимистичного параллельного выполнения. Транзакции предполагаются без конфликтов и обрабатываются одновременно, если после выполнения обнаруживаются конфликты, затронутые транзакции будут повторно выполнены. Этот подход в полной мере использует производительность многопроцессорных систем, что позволяет достичь TPS в 160,000.

Обновление статуса

Состояние синхронизации валидаторов, финальность подтверждается контрольной точкой, аналогично механизму Epoch в Эфире, но более эффективно.

Основное преимущество Aptos заключается в сочетании оптимистичного параллелизма и предварительной сортировки в пуле памяти, что снижает требования к производительности узлов и значительно повышает пропускную способность.

Ethereum: Бенчмарк последовательного исполнения

Ethereum как создатель смарт-контрактов предоставляет базовую структуру для понимания других публичных блокчейнов.

Жизненный цикл транзакций Ethereum

  • Создание и инициирование: пользователи инициируют транзакции через кошелек, используя релейные шлюзы или интерфейс RPC.
  • Трансляция: Сделка попадает в общую память, ожидая упаковки.
  • Сортировка: После обновления PoS строители блоков упаковывают транзакции в соответствии с принципом максимизации прибыли и после торга на промежуточном уровне передают их предложителю.
  • Выполнение: EVM последовательно обрабатывает транзакции, обновляя состояние в одном потоке.
  • Обновление статуса: Блок должен пройти два контрольных пункта для подтверждения окончательности.

Параллельное выполнение и оптимизация пулов памяти Aptos обеспечивают качественный скачок по сравнению с ограничениями производительности последовательного выполнения и дизайна пулов памяти Ethereum, время блока составляет 12 секунд/слот, TPS низкий.

Глубокое и простое понимание основных различий между Ethereum, Solana и Aptos в жизненном цикле одной транзакции

Solana: крайняя оптимизация с детерминированным параллелизмом

Solana известен высокой производительностью, его жизненный цикл транзакций значительно отличается от Aptos, особенно в отношении пула памяти и способов выполнения.

Жизненный цикл транзакций Solana

  • Создание и инициирование: пользователь инициирует транзакцию через кошелек.
  • Трансляция: нет общих пулов памяти, транзакции отправляются напрямую текущему и двум следующим предложителям.
  • Сортировка: Предложитель упаковывает блоки на основе PoH (Доказательство Истории), время блока составляет всего 400 миллисекунд.
  • Исполнение: Виртуальная машина Sealevel использует детерминированное параллельное выполнение, необходимо заранее объявить наборы чтения и записи, чтобы избежать конфликтов.
  • Обновление статуса: консенсус BFT быстро подтверждается.

Solana не использует пул памяти, чтобы избежать узких мест в производительности. Такой дизайн позволяет быстро достигать последовательного консенсуса по транзакциям, практически обеспечивая мгновенное выполнение. Однако в случае перегрузки сети транзакции могут быть отклонены, а не ожидать, и пользователю придется повторно отправить их.

В отличие от этого, оптимистичное параллельное выполнение Aptos не требует объявления наборов на чтение и запись, что снижает порог для узлов и одновременно обеспечивает более высокую TPS.

Два пути параллельного выполнения: Aptos против Solana

Параллельное выполнение в Блокчейне относится к процессу, при котором многопроцессорные системы одновременно вычисляют состояние сети. В настоящее время параллельное выполнение на рынке в основном делится на два типа: детерминированное параллельное выполнение и оптимистичное параллельное выполнение. Их основное отличие заключается в том, как обеспечить отсутствие конфликтов между параллельными транзакциями.

  • Детерминированный параллелизм (Solana): перед трансляцией транзакций необходимо объявить наборы для чтения и записи, движок Sealevel обрабатывает параллельные транзакции без конфликтов в соответствии с объявлением, конфликтующие транзакции выполняются последовательно. Преимущества заключаются в высокой эффективности, недостаток - в высоких требованиях к оборудованию.

  • Оптимистичное параллельное выполнение (Aptos): предполагается, что транзакции не конфликтуют, параллельное выполнение Block-STM проверяется после выполнения, если есть конфликт, то повторная попытка. Предварительная сортировка в памяти снижает риск конфликтов, нагрузка на узлы становится легче.

Например, предположим, что баланс счета A составляет 100, транзакция 1 переводит 70 на счет B, транзакция 2 переводит 50 на счет C. Solana будет заранее подтверждать конфликты через декларацию и обрабатывать их последовательно; тогда как Aptos будет выполнять параллельно, и если обнаружит недостаток средств, то пересчитает. Эта гибкость Aptos делает его более масштабируемым.

Глубокое и простое понимание основных различий между Ethereum, Solana и Aptos в жизненном цикле одной сделки

Оптимистичное параллельное завершение подтверждения конфликтов через пул памяти

Оптимистичное параллельное выполнение Aptos не просто предполагает отсутствие конфликтов между транзакциями, а заранее избегает рисков на этапе их трансляции. После того как транзакции попадают в общую память, они предварительно сортируются по определенным правилам (таким как FIFO и уровень газовых сборов), чтобы гарантировать, что транзакции в одном блоке не будут конфликтовать при параллельном выполнении.

Эта предсортировка транзакций является ключевым моментом для реализации оптимистичного параллелизма в Aptos. В отличие от Solana, где требуется вводить декларации транзакций, Aptos не нуждается в этой механике, что значительно снижает требования к производительности узлов. Что касается сетевых затрат на обеспечение отсутствия конфликтов транзакций, влияние пула памяти в Aptos на TPS намного меньше, чем стоимость внедрения деклараций транзакций в Solana. Таким образом, TPS Aptos может достигать 160 000, что более чем в два раза превышает Solana.

Направление развития Aptos: нарратив, основанный на безопасности

RWA ( Реальные активы)

Aptos активно продвигает токенизацию реальных активов и решения для институциональных финансов. Его Block-STM может параллельно обрабатывать несколько транзакций по передаче активов, избегая задержек подтверждения из-за перегрузки сети. Предварительная сортировка в пуле памяти обеспечивает последовательное выполнение транзакций, поддерживая надежность записей активов. Модульный дизайн и безопасность языка Move позволяют разработчикам легче строить надежные приложения RWA.

Потенциал Aptos в области RWA заключается в сочетании безопасности и производительности. В будущем можно сосредоточиться на сотрудничестве с традиционными финансовыми учреждениями для токенизации высокоценного актива с использованием языка Move для создания стандартов токенизации с высокой степенью соответствия.

В июле 2024 года Aptos представляет USDY от Ondo Finance и интегрирует его в основные DEX и приложения для кредитования. В октябре 2024 года Franklin Templeton запускает токен BENJI на Aptos. Кроме того, Aptos сотрудничает с Libre для продвижения токенизации ценных бумаг, переводя в блокчейн несколько известных инвестиционных фондов, чтобы улучшить доступ институциональных инвесторов.

Платежи стабильной валютой

Язык Move от Aptos предотвращает двойные траты благодаря модели ресурсов, обеспечивая точность переводов стейблкоинов. Низкие комиссии за газ делают его очень конкурентоспособным в сценариях мелких платежей. Предварительная сортировка в памяти и Block-STM гарантируют стабильность и низкую задержку платежных транзакций.

Децентрализованный консенсус AptosBFT снижает риски централизации, в то время как его модульная архитектура поддерживает внедрение проверок KYC/AML разработчиками, балансируя между децентрализацией и требованиями регуляторного соблюдения.

Потенциал Aptos в области PayFi и стабильных монет заключается в триаде "безопасность, эффективность, соответствие". В будущем это может способствовать массовому применению стабильных монет, созданию сети трансакций через границы или сотрудничеству с платежными гигантами для разработки системы расчетов на блокчейне. Высокая TPS и низкие затраты также могут поддерживать сценарии микроплатежей, такие как пожертвования контентным создателям в реальном времени.

Глубокое и простое понимание основных различий между Ethereum, Solana и Aptos на протяжении жизненного цикла одной транзакции

Резюме: Технические различия Aptos и будущая нарратив

Дизайн Aptos достиг баланса между производительностью и безопасностью. Предварительная сортировка пула памяти в сочетании с оптимистичным параллелизмом Block-STM снижает порог для узлов и обеспечивает высокую пропускную способность в 160 000 TPS. Этот подход «стабильности через скорость», дополненный ресурсной моделью языка Move, придает Aptos более высокую безопасность.

Основываясь на сочетании безопасности и производительности, Aptos демонстрирует огромный потенциал в нарративах RWA и PayFi. В области RWA Aptos поддерживает масштабируемую токенизацию активов и уже сотрудничает с несколькими финансовыми учреждениями. В PayFi и платежах со стабильными монетами Aptos с низкими издержками, высокой эффективностью и соблюдением нормативных требований поддерживает микроплатежи и трансакции через границы, что делает его многообещающим "инфраструктурой следующего поколения для платежей".

В будущем Aptos сможет соединить традиционные финансы и экосистему Блокчейн благодаря нарративу "ценностной сети, движимой безопасностью", продолжая усилия в области RWA и PayFi, создавая новую архитектуру публичной цепи, которая сочетает в себе доверие и масштабируемость.

Глубокое понимание основных отличий между Ethereum, Solana и Aptos в жизненном цикле одной транзакции

APT1.43%
RWA-3.93%
Посмотреть Оригинал
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
  • Награда
  • 8
  • Поделиться
комментарий
0/400
CoffeeNFTsvip
· 07-25 14:44
сол маленький принц
Посмотреть ОригиналОтветить0
ETHReserveBankvip
· 07-25 12:32
Эти несколько цепочек, похоже, sol разочарование, да?
Посмотреть ОригиналОтветить0
DeFiVeteranvip
· 07-22 16:42
Почему технологии так плохи? Уже давно превзошли Ethereum.
Посмотреть ОригиналОтветить0
OffchainOraclevip
· 07-22 16:42
苟住aptos эта волна На луну
Посмотреть ОригиналОтветить0
wrekt_but_learningvip
· 07-22 16:41
Технические различия так велики, я все равно выбираю ETH для надежности.
Посмотреть ОригиналОтветить0
CountdownToBrokevip
· 07-22 16:37
Покупай покупай покупай, кому какое дело, какая это цепочка~
Посмотреть ОригиналОтветить0
DegenMcsleeplessvip
· 07-22 16:36
aptos не выдержит, ждите большой дамп.
Посмотреть ОригиналОтветить0
FromMinerToFarmervip
· 07-22 16:32
Выращивал землю 0x, поливал водой sol, теперь ухаживаю за apt

Пожалуйста, оставьте комментарий на китайском:

Не понял, только умею заниматься земледелием.
Посмотреть ОригиналОтветить0
  • Закрепить